Overview
The AD7870LPZ is a fast, complete 12-bit analog-to-digital converter (ADC) produced by Analog Devices Inc. This device integrates a track-and-hold amplifier, an 8 μs successive approximation ADC, a 3 V buried Zener reference, and versatile interface logic on a single chip. It features a self-contained internal clock that is laser-trimmed for accurate control of conversion time, eliminating the need for external clock timing components. The AD7870LPZ supports three data output formats: a single parallel 12-bit word, two 8-bit bytes, or serial data. This makes it highly compatible with modern microprocessors and digital signal processors due to its fast bus access times and standard control inputs.
Key Specifications
Parameter | Value |
---|---|
Resolution | 12 bits |
Conversion Time | 8 μs |
Input Signal Range | ±3 V |
Power Supply | ±5 V |
Maximum Sampling Rate | 100 kHz |
Data Output Formats | Parallel 12-bit word, two 8-bit bytes, or serial data |
Package Type | 28-pin PLCC (Plastic Leaded Chip Carrier) |
Operating Temperature Range | 0°C to +70°C |
Power Consumption | Typically 60 mW |
Key Features
- Complete 12-bit ADC on a single chip, including track-and-hold amplifier, successive approximation ADC, and 3 V buried Zener reference.
- Self-contained internal clock with the option to override with an external clock.
- Fast bus access times of 57 ns, ensuring compatibility with modern microprocessors and digital signal processors.
- Dynamic performance specifications including signal-to-noise ratio, harmonic distortion, and intermodulation distortion.
- Multiple data output formats: parallel 12-bit word, two 8-bit bytes, or serial data.
- Operates from ±5 V power supplies.
- Available in 28-pin PLCC package.
